Siirry suoraan sisältöön

Master's Degree Programme in Information Technology, Full Stack Software Development: YTS2018KYA

Opetussuunitelman tunnus: YTS2018KYA

Tutkintonimike
Insinööri (ylempi AMK), tietotekniikka
Laajuus
60 op
Kesto
2 vuotta (60 op)
Aloituslukukausi
Kevät 2018
Opetuskieli
englanti

Näytä opintojen ajoitukset lukuvuosittain, lukukausittain tai periodeittain

Tunnus Opinnon nimi Laajuus (op) 2017-2018 2018-2019 2019-2020 Kevät 2018 Syksy 2018 Kevät 2019 Syksy 2019 3. / 2018 4. / 2018 5. / 2018 1. / 2018 2. / 2018 3. / 2019 4. / 2019 5. / 2019 1. / 2019
YTS10Z-1005
PROFESSIONAL STUDIES

(Valitaan kaikki )

20
YTSP0100 Modern Software Development 5 5 5 2.5 2.5
YTSP0200 Data Modelling and Back-end Development 5 5 5 2.5 2.5
YTSP0300 Application Frameworks 5 5 5 2.5 2.5
YTSP0400 User-Centered Design 5 5 5 2.5 2.5
YTS20Z-1005
ELECTIVE STUDIES

(Valitaan opintopisteitä: 10 )

0 - 10
YIIP1400 Advanced Technology 5 5 5 5
YIIZ0Z-1036
MASTER'S THESIS

(Valitaan kaikki )

30
YIIZ0100 Master's Thesis, part 1 10 10 10 3.3 3.3 3.3
YIIZ0200 Master's Thesis, part 2 20 16.7 3.3 6.7 10 3.3 3.3 3.3 3.3 3.3 3.3 3.3
YIIZ0300 Maturity Test 0
Yhteensä 60 20 31.7 3.3 20 16.7 15 3.3 5.8 5.8 8.3 8.3 8.3 5.8 5.8 3.3 3.3

YAMK: JAMKin yhteiset osaamiset 2017-2018

Kansainvälisyysosaaminen

- viestii taitavasti toisella kotimaisella ja vähintään yhdellä vieraalla kielellä työtehtävissään ja toiminnan kehittämisessä sekä kansainvälisissä yhteyksissä
- toimii kansainvälisissä toimintaympäristöissä
- ennakoi kansainvälisyyskehityksen vaikutuksia ja mahdollisuuksia omalla ammattialallaan.

Ei liitettyjä opintojaksoja

Oppimisen taidot

- arvioi ja kehittää monipuolisesti ja tavoitteellisesti asiantuntijuuttaan ja on valmis jatkuvaan oppimiseen
- hallitsee alansa erityisosaamista vastaavat tiedot, teoriat, käsitteet ja menetelmät ja arvioi niitä kriittisesti ja eri alojen näkökulmista
- ottaa vastuun yhteisön tavoitteellisesta oppimisesta.

Master's Thesis, part 1
Tiedonhallintaosaaminen

- kartuttaaa, käsittelee ja tuottaa uutta tietoa ja uudistaa toimintatapoja yhdistäen myös eri alojen osaamista
- ratkaisee vaativia ongelmia tutkimus-, kehitys- ja innovaatiotoiminnassa
- osallistuu ja johtaa yhteiskunnallisesti vaikuttavaa toimintaa eettisiin arvoihin perustuen.

Master's Thesis, part 1
Master's Thesis, part 2
Työelämäosaaminen

- soveltaa alansa ammattieettisiä periaatteita sekä kestävän kehityksen mukaisia työ- ja toimintatapoja
- kehittää työyhteisön, kumppanuusverkostojen sekä ryhmien toimintaa niiden jäsenenä ja edistää yhteisön hyvinvointia
- johtaa asioita ja ihmisiä sekä kehittää ennakoiden uusia strategisia lähestymistapoja.

Master's Thesis, part 2
Viestintäosaaminen

- viestii hyvin suullisesti ja kirjallisesti äidinkielellään erilaisissa työympäristöissä
- kehittää työelämän monialaista viestintää ja vuorovaikutusta
- tekee ratkaisuja ottaen huomioon yksilön ja yhteisön sekä tasa-arvoisuuden periaatteiden näkökulmat.

Master's Thesis, part 1
Master's Thesis, part 2
Maturity Test
Yrittäjyysosaaminen

- työskentee itsenäisesti ja yhteistoiminnallisesti alan vaativissa asiantuntijatehtävissä tai yrittäjänä
- kehittää ja luo uutta asiakaslähtöistä, kestävää ja taloudellisesti kannattavaa toimintaa
- johtaa soveltavia tutkimus-, kehittämis- ja innovaatiohankkeita.

Ei liitettyjä opintojaksoja

Luokittelemattomat
Modern Software Development
Data Modelling and Back-end Development
Application Frameworks
User-Centered Design
Advanced Technology

YAMK: Information Technology, Full Stack Software Development 2017-2019

Business Orientation

The student
- understands business domain in different industrial sectors of software development
- understands financial implications, including costs vs. benefits of software development.

User-Centered Design
Developmental skills

The student
- carries out a business-driven project and applies the methods learned during the software development
- masters the principles of project documentation.

Data Modelling and Back-end Development
Application Frameworks
Full stack implementation

The student
- knows principles and methodologies to build a full stack solution
- can design and implement different parts of a full stack solution
- understands the importance of technical security policies.

Modern Software Development
Data Modelling and Back-end Development
Application Frameworks
Software Development

The student
- understands terminology and principles of software development lifecycle
- knows the layers of typical software stack.

Modern Software Development
Advanced Technology
Software testing

The student
- knows the software testing methods and techniques
- can design and implement testing processes.

Application Frameworks
User-Centered Design
Luokittelemattomat
Master's Thesis, part 1
Master's Thesis, part 2
Maturity Test

Tunnus Opinnon nimi Laajuus (op)
YTS10Z-1005
PROFESSIONAL STUDIES

(Valitaan kaikki )

20
YTSP0100 Modern Software Development 5
YTSP0200 Data Modelling and Back-end Development 5
YTSP0300 Application Frameworks 5
YTSP0400 User-Centered Design 5
YTS20Z-1005
ELECTIVE STUDIES

(Valitaan opintopisteitä: 10 )

0 - 10
YIIP1400 Advanced Technology 5
YIIZ0Z-1036
MASTER'S THESIS

(Valitaan kaikki )

30
YIIZ0100 Master's Thesis, part 1 10
YIIZ0200 Master's Thesis, part 2 20
YIIZ0300 Maturity Test 0

Lukukausi- ja lukuvuosikohtaiset opintopistekertymät vaihtelevat valinnaisten ja vapaasti valittavien opintojen ajoituksesta johtuen.

Siirry alkuun